TEXT ME WHEN YOU GET HOME //PERSONAL PROJECT AND EXHIBITION, 2021

Illustrations for ‘Text me when you get home’ online exhibition, curated by The Impulse Movement and CuratorSpace, available at Artsteps.

“Following the disappearance of 33-year-old, Sarah Everard, and the response to it - has led to many people sharing stories of fear about women’s safety and the fear of walking alone, being out in public and living in society”.

Keys between fingers, walking in the middle of the road, avoiding gasps in hedges or entrances to alleyways, phone on, headphones out, cross the road, check over your shoulder.
